Carrying NASA science and technology to the Moon, Intuitive Machines’ uncrewed lunar lander touched down at 5:23 p.m. CST on Thursday. The instruments aboard Odysseus will prepare NASA for future human exploration of the Moon under Artemis. Additional updates will be available Friday, Feb. 23.

After a successful lunar orbit insertion, Odysseus is currently orbiting the Moon, approximately 12 miles above the lunar surface. Carrying six NASA science investigations and technology demonstrations, the Intuitive Machines lander is expected to land at 6:24 p.m. EST near Malapert A in the south polar region of the Moon. Intuitive Machines’ Nova-C lander successfully powered on, made communications contact, and is now on its way to the Moon, carrying NASA science and technology demonstrations as part of the agency’s CLPS (Commercial Lunar Payload Services) initiative and Artemis campaign.
